Your Beagle puppy will certainly have a huge appetite so you have to be careful about what food and how much you can give to avoid overeating.

A beagle puppy needs high quality dry food. Table scraps are certainly a no-no. Dry food is good while their teeth are still developing. It also prevent dental carries.

An expensive brand of dog food does not necessarily mean that it is the best, you have to read the fine lines and see for yourself. There are less expensive dog food out there which can still provide the nutrients needed for your growing puppy.

Have you noticed that after eating grass a dog throws up? This may be an innate instinct to self-medicate in an effort to get rid of harmful or undesirable substances present in the esophagus or the stomach.
